logo

Output 90333dbaf90a5724c0503157d66e1253a9eb56b449a7ade762ccb1a34d4ef248:0

value
4421440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c7665239d1128169c1145abfbc3b63fb30f7b99 OP_EQUALVERIFY OP_CHECKSIG
address
17yJBpAKbKeyDvu5AivTVDkb3YKRisQ9LT
transaction
90333dbaf90a5724c0503157d66e1253a9eb56b449a7ade762ccb1a34d4ef248